以太坊原理动画讲解,让区块链智能起来的可视化指南
当人们谈论区块链时,比特币常被视作“数字黄金”的代表,而以太坊则被誉为“世界计算机”——它不仅能记录交易,还能通过“智能合约”实现自动执行的复杂逻辑,但以太坊的底层原理究竟是什么?为什么它能支持如此多样的应用(如DeFi、NFT、DAO)?本文将通过“动画化”的比喻和分步解析,带你轻松理解以太坊的核心机制。

从“账本”到“计算机”:以太坊的定位升级
要理解以太坊,先对比比特币:比特币本质上是一个分布式账本,主要记录“谁转了多少比特币给谁”,功能相对单一,而以太坊的目标是构建一个去中心化的虚拟机(Ethereum Virtual Machine, EVM),让开发者可以在区块链上编写和运行任意程序(即“智能合约”),就像在电脑上运行APP一样。
动画比喻:如果把比特币比作一本“只能记录转账的笔记本”,以太坊就是一台“可以安装各种软件的电脑”——你可以在上面安装“银行APP”(DeFi)、“游戏平台”(NFT游戏)、“投票系统”(DAO)等,所有程序都在全球无数台电脑上同步运行,不受任何单一机构控制。
以太坊的“骨架”:区块链 状态机
以太坊的底层依然是区块链技术,但它记录的内容更复杂——除了交易,还包括整个网络的“状态”(State)。
- 区块链:由一个个“区块”组成,每个区块包含多笔“交易记录”,新区块通过“工作量证明”(PoW,未来将转向权益证明PoS)链接到前一个区块,形成不可篡改的链式结构。
- 状态机:以太坊的“状态”是一个全局数据库,记录了当前所有账户的余额、智能合约的代码和存储数据等,每笔交易都会修改这个状态,比如转账会改变账户余额,调用智能合约会更新合约存储。
动画演示:想象一张巨大的“电子表格”(状态机),全球每个人都能看到,当你发起一笔交易(比如转账1个ETH),交易被打包进一个“区块”(表格的一行),所有参与者同步更新这张表格,从此,这张表格的最新状态就包含了你的转账记录,且无法被篡改。
智能合约:以太坊的“自动执行逻辑”
智能合约是以太坊的灵魂,它是一段部署在区块链上的代码,一旦满足预设条件,就会自动执行,无需第三方信任。
核心特点:

- 去信任化:合约的执行由网络节点共同验证,不受个人或机构干预。
- 不可篡改:合约代码部署后无法修改,确保逻辑稳定。
- 自动触发:比如一个“众筹智能合约”,设定“筹集到100ETH后自动给项目方打款,到期未筹齐则自动退款”,整个过程无需人工操作。
动画比喻:智能合约就像一个“自动售货机”:你投入特定数量的代币(投币),机器自动验证(检查余额),然后掉出对应的商品(执行合约逻辑),整个过程公开透明,且机器的“程序”(合约代码)无法被偷偷修改。
账户模型:EOA与合约账户的“双主角”
以太坊有两种账户类型,共同构成了网络的参与者:

- 外部拥有账户(EOA):由用户控制的账户,本质是“私钥签名”的地址,比如你的钱包地址就是EOA,它有余额,可以发起交易,但不能主动执行逻辑(只能“调用”合约)。
- 合约账户:由智能合约创建的账户,没有私钥,代码和存储数据永久记录在区块链上,它只能被EOA或其他合约“调用”后,才会执行逻辑(比如转账、修改数据)。
动画演示:EOA像“人的手”,可以主动按按钮(发起交易);合约账户像“自动售货机”,只有被“手”按下按钮后才会工作,两者通过“交易”互动,共同推动网络运行。
Gas机制:防止“网络拥堵”的“燃料费”
以太坊是公有链,全球任何人都能提交交易或部署合约,如果没有限制,恶意用户可能通过大量无意义操作(比如死循环代码)耗尽网络资源,导致系统瘫痪。
Gas机制:每笔交易都需要支付“Gas费”,用ETH计价,Gas是衡量计算资源的单位,简单操作(如转账)消耗少量Gas,复杂操作(如运行智能合约)消耗大量Gas,Gas费支付给打包交易的“矿工”(或验证者),激励他们维护网络安全。
动画比喻:Gas就像汽车的“汽油”,你想开车(发起交易),必须先加油(支付Gas费),开得越远、越复杂(计算量越大),消耗的汽油越多,如果没有汽油,车就动不了;恶意“飙车”(无意义操作)不仅浪费自己的汽油,还会占用道路(网络资源),而加油站(矿工)优先给“汽油多”的车加油,确保高效运行。
Merkle Patricia Trie:高效验证数据的“数据结构魔法”
以太坊需要高效存储和验证海量数据(所有账户状态、交易记录等),这依赖于一种特殊的数据结构——Merkle Patricia Trie(MPT)。
- Merkle树:将所有数据哈希(加密摘要)后两两配对,再对哈希结果继续配对哈希,最终得到一个“根哈希”,只要数据有任何变动,根哈希就会改变,且可以快速验证某个数据是否属于集合。
- Patricia Trie:一种压缩前缀树,通过共享公共路径进一步减少存储空间,提高查询效率。
动画演示:想象一棵“倒立的树”,每个叶子节点是一笔交易,每个分支节点是哈希值,树顶的“根哈希”记录在区块头中,当你验证某笔交易时,无需下载全部数据,只需提供从该叶子节点到根节点的“哈希路径”,其他节点通过快速计算即可确认交易是否存在,极大提升了效率。
从PoW到PoS:以太坊的“节能升级”
以太坊最初采用比特币的工作量证明(PoW)机制,依赖矿工算力竞争记账,但能耗高、效率低,2022年,以太坊通过“合并”(The Merge)升级至权益证明(PoS),大幅降低能耗。
PoS机制:验证者(替代矿工)通过质押ETH(锁定作为保证金)获得记账权,验证者作恶(如双重记账)会被扣除质押的ETH(“惩罚”),诚实验证者则获得奖励,PoS不再依赖“算力竞赛”,而是依赖“权益 诚实”,更环保、高效。
动画比喻:PoW像“体力竞赛”(谁力气大谁赢),PoS像“信誉竞赛”(谁质押多且诚实谁赢),以太坊从“体力大赛”升级为“信誉大赛”,既保证了网络安全,又减少了“能源消耗”。
动画让复杂原理“触手可及”
以太坊的原理看似抽象,但通过动画化的比喻——从“自动售货机”的智能合约,到“汽油”的Gas机制,再到“信誉竞赛”的PoS——我们可以直观理解其核心逻辑,正是这些创新机制,让以太坊从“数字货币”进化为“去中心化应用平台”,为Web3时代奠定了基础设施。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。




